[STATUS: ONLINE] 当サイトは要約付きのエンジニア向けFeedです。

TechDistill.dev

[DISCLAIMER] 当サイトの要約は正確性を保証しません。気になる記事は必ず原文を確認してください。
cd ..

【要約】Excel業務を壊さずAPI化する設計入門:現場を敵にしないDXの作り方 [Qiita_Trend] | Summary by TechDistill

> Source: Qiita_Trend
Execute Primary Source

// Problem

DX担当者がExcel業務をシステムへ移行しようとする際、現場の業務フローを無視してツールを全廃することで失敗する。現場は例外的な顧客要望や複雑な計算に対応するため、Excelを柔軟なUIとして利用している。具体的には以下の問題が発生する。


  • Excel内に入力、計算、判断、履歴が混在している。
  • 計算式がブラックボックス化し、監査が困難である。
  • 最新の単価や制度データが分散し、正本が存在しない。
  • AIに計算を任せると、不正確な結果を生成するリスクがある。

// Approach

エンジニアは業務を3層構造に分解し、Excelを「入力と確認のUI」として再定義するアプローチをとる。計算ロジックやマスターデータをAPI/DB層へ逃がし、責任の所在を明確にする。具体的な手法は以下の通りである。


  • UI層:ExcelやGoogle Sheetsを人間用のインターフェースとする。
  • AI層:要約や下書きなどの曖昧な処理を担当させる。
  • API/DB層:正本計算、マスター管理、監査ログ保存を担う。
  • Backend Proxy:Excelから直接APIを呼ばず、中間層で認証やエラー翻訳を行う。
  • エラー設計:HTTPステータスを現場が理解できる言葉に翻訳して返す。

// Result

この設計により、現場の使い勝手を損なわずに、データの整合性と業務の透明性を確保できる。導入ステップを段階的に踏むことで、移行リスクを最小化できる。


  • 現場の抵抗を抑え、Excelを使い続けながらDXを進められる。
  • 計算ロジックがAPI化され、再現性と監査性が向上する。
  • AIエージェントやBPOが安全に業務に介入できる基盤が整う。
  • エネがえるAPIのような業務特化APIの活用で、開発負荷を軽減できる。

Senior Engineer Insight

> 本記事の肝は「Excelを捨てるのではなく、責任を剥がす」という思想にある。単なるAPI化ではなく、Backendを介したエラーの「現場語翻訳」や、認証情報の隠蔽といった実務的な設計が極めて実践的だ。特に、AIに正本計算をさせないという境界線の引き方は、LLM時代のシステム設計において必須の知見といえる。スケーラビリティと運用保守性を両立させるための、極めて現実的な解である。

[ RELATED_KERNELS_DETECTED ]

cd ..

> System.About()

TechDistillは、膨大な技術記事から情報の真髄(Kernel)のみを抽出・提示します。